What is Clean Energy?

As the name suggests, clean energy, which does not cause pollution to the environment, can be expressed as energy that has zero emission production and is obtained from renewable resources. Logically, clean energy has an environmentally friendly structure that will not pollute the atmosphere when used. However, the energy saved in terms of energy efficiency can also be called clean energy.

The sources used today as clean energy include solar energy, geothermal energy, wind energy, biomass energy, hydroelectricity, and hydrogen energy. As expected, the most basic feature of these sources is that they do not have a negative impact on the environment.

Although renewable energy comes directly to mind when it comes to clean energy today, these two concepts are not entirely synonymous. Because not all renewable energy sources may have a clean structure in a broad framework. For example, in order to obtain energy by establishing a hydroelectric power plant, construction activities must be carried out in the installation area, trees must be cut down in the region and some destruction must be caused.

Considering at the use of clean energy in Turkey, especially in terms of geographical location, Turkey has a very rich structure in this respect. Because Turkey is surrounded by seas on three sides, and for most of the year, the sun’s rays reach all 81 provinces efficiently and rich clean energy resources are obtained.

In Turkey, for example, the Mediterranean and Aegean regions can get high efficiency from solar energy, while Thrace and the Aegean region, even Çanakkale and Afyon regions, have very intense wind energy opportunities and large geothermal energy reserves. Especially since our country does not have enough resources to meet its total energy needs from fossil resources, if it utilizes its clean energy potential, it can meet its needs without being dependent on foreign energy.

Which Sources Can Be Used for Clean Energy?

While there are different sources as mentioned before to obtain clean energy, sources that do not create greenhouse gas emissions such as carbon dioxide and methane and do not create harmful effects on the environment should be used to obtain this energy. In this respect, clean energy sources can be briefly reviewed.

  • While solar energy is the first source in this regard, in the projects applied for this energy, the light and heat from the sun are converted into electrical energy and used. The solar panels needed for this project can be preferred to meet the energy needs of homes, workplaces or any region. Especially in a country like Turkey, where the number of sunny days per year is very high, it can be considered as the clean energy source that can be used the most.
  • Geothermal energy is recognized as a resource utilized in many different countries around the world. Although our country has a wide range of opportunities in this regard, energy is obtained thanks to the heat, hot water and steam emerging in the deep regions of the earth’s crust. While these geothermal resources are used for electricity and heat generation, they are both renewable, economical and environmentally friendly.
  • Wind energy, on the other hand, utilizes the pressure change in the air caused by the wind and converts the movement into electricity through wind turbines. While wind power plants are frequently installed in Turkey, especially in the Thrace and Aegean regions, it is a resource that requires less space than other clean energy projects and can produce energy in all seasons.
  • Biomass energy is the production of energy by utilizing organic methods from agricultural residues and animal wastes called waste. In this method, as long as the waste is obtained uninterruptedly, it has the potential to provide continuous energy, not intermittent like solar and wind energy.
  • Finally, if hydrogen energy is considered, energy is obtained through the processing of hydrogen gas. A sustainable and clean energy source is provided through the use of hydrogen in fuel cells.

In Which Areas Are Clean Energy Sources Used?

Although the first thing that comes to mind when it comes to energy is meeting the need for electricity, clean energy sources today have a structure that can meet the needs at many different points. In other words, although clean energy sources are primarily used for electricity generation, it is also possible to utilize these resources in many different processes such as lighting, cooling and heating.

In the use of clean energy, for example, when the energy received from sunlight is converted into electricity through solar panels; needs such as both lighting and heating can be met in a building. Today, solar energy is known to provide a structure that is encountered in many areas such as battery charging with different technologies, charging vehicles, using solar lighting.

Clean energy provides resources that can be used to create the energy infrastructure required for all needs such as electricity use and heating/cooling in both homes and businesses today thanks to technological investments.

What Disadvantages Does Clean Energy Have?

Although clean energy has many advantages for a sustainable energy policy, it also has some disadvantages. To briefly touch on these details:

  • It has limitations in certain geographies and climates.
  • Some clean energy projects have very high installation costs.
  • There is a limited storage capacity for storing clean energy.
  • In some sources, energy interruptions may be encountered depending on the season and weather conditions.
